引言
在当今信息时代,个人博客已成为展示自我、分享知识的重要平台。使用GitHub来托管个人博客,不仅能够提高博客的可维护性,还能享受到版本控制的便利。本篇文章将详细介绍如何利用PHP搭建个人博客并将其托管到GitHub上。
什么是GitHub?
GitHub是一个基于云的版本控制和协作平台,广泛用于开源项目和个人项目的管理。它允许用户存储代码、跟踪项目进度和协作。
GitHub的特点
- 版本控制:能轻松追踪代码的更改历史。
- 开源支持:便于共享和协作。
- 项目管理:可创建问题跟踪、拉取请求等。
PHP简介
PHP(Hypertext Preprocessor)是一种广泛使用的开源脚本语言,尤其适用于网页开发。它可以嵌入HTML中,为网页提供动态内容。
PHP的优势
- 易学性:对于新手友好,易于上手。
- 强大的功能:支持数据库操作、会话管理等。
- 丰富的生态:有大量的框架和库可供使用。
如何在GitHub上搭建个人博客
搭建个人博客主要包括以下几个步骤:
第一步:创建GitHub账号
- 访问GitHub官网。
- 点击注册按钮,填写相关信息,完成注册。
- 验证邮箱,登录账号。
第二步:创建新的仓库
- 登录后,点击右上角的“+”号,选择“New repository”。
- 输入仓库名称,例如
my-blog
。 - 选择公开或私有仓库,并点击“Create repository”。
第三步:搭建PHP博客
- 下载WordPress:访问WordPress官网下载最新版本。
- 上传到GitHub:将下载的文件解压,并将其上传至刚创建的GitHub仓库。
- 配置数据库:在GitHub中,您需要使用GitHub Pages和其他服务组合以模拟数据库功能。
第四步:配置GitHub Pages
- 在仓库设置中,找到“GitHub Pages”选项。
- 选择分支,通常是
main
或master
。 - 点击保存后,GitHub会为您生成一个网址,您可以通过这个网址访问您的博客。
第五步:添加内容和主题
- 选择主题:WordPress有许多免费的主题可供选择。
- 创建博客文章:在WordPress后台创建新的博客文章。
部署与维护
- 定期更新:保持WordPress和主题的更新,以防止安全问题。
- 备份数据:定期备份代码和博客内容。
FAQ
如何在GitHub上托管我的个人博客?
您可以创建一个新的GitHub仓库并上传您的博客代码,随后配置GitHub Pages来使您的博客在线可见。
GitHub Pages是否支持PHP?
GitHub Pages并不支持运行PHP代码,但您可以使用其他静态网站生成器或将PHP代码托管到其他平台,如Heroku等。
如何提高我博客的SEO?
- 使用关键字优化标题和内容。
- 添加元描述和标签。
- 定期更新内容,保持活跃。
WordPress和其他博客平台的区别是什么?
WordPress提供了强大的功能和丰富的插件支持,适合需要自定义的用户。而其他平台可能更简化,但灵活性和功能可能较少。
总结
使用GitHub和PHP搭建个人博客是一种很好的方式,它可以帮助您展示自己的技能和思想。在这个过程中,您不仅学习了如何使用GitHub进行版本控制,还能深入了解PHP开发。希望这篇文章能帮助到有志于创建个人博客的您!
正文完